find the LCM of m^2 - 4m - 5 and m^2 + 8m + 7

Answer:

LCM=(m+1)(m-5)(m+7)

Step-by-step explanation:

Given expressions are [tex]m^2-4m-5[/tex] and [tex]m^2+8m+7[/tex].

To find the LCM, first we need to find factors of both expressions.

[tex]m^2-4m-5[/tex]

[tex]=m^2+1m-5m-5[/tex]

[tex]=m(m+1)-5(m+1)[/tex]

[tex]=(m+1)(m-5)[/tex]

Similarly factor other expression

[tex]m^2+8m+7[/tex]

[tex]=(m+1)(m+7)[/tex]

Common factor in both is (m+1)

bring down remaining non-common factors.

So LCM=(m+1)(m-5)(m+7)
